How Roofing System Ventilation Works
Efficient roof ventilation relies on the natural movement of air to produce an equilibrium in between intake and exhaust. When you install vents, you're basically enabling fresh air to enter your attic room while allowing warm, stale air to leave. This process aids regulate temperature level and wetness levels, preventing concerns like mold and mildew growth and roofing system damage.
Intake vents, commonly discovered at the eaves, draw in great air from outside. Meanwhile, exhaust vents, situated near the ridge of the roof, allow hot air rise and leave. The distinction in temperature level produces an all-natural air movement, called the pile impact. As cozy air surges, it produces a vacuum cleaner that draws in cooler air from the reduced vents.
To optimize this system, you need to make sure that the intake and exhaust vents are effectively sized and positioned. If the consumption is limited, you will not attain the preferred ventilation.
Also, insufficient exhaust can catch warmth and wetness, resulting in possible damages.
